Do not use Hashtable in your new applications. Use HashMap if you do not need councurrency. In concurrent environment, prefer to use ConcurrentHashMap. Drop me your questions in comments. Happy Learning !! Reference: Hashtable Java Docs...
at java.util.Hashtable.put(Unknown Source) at test.core.MapExamples.main(MapExamples.java:12) 1.3. 遗留 Hashtable是一个遗留类,不是最初的Java集合框架的一部分(后来在JDK 1.2中包括了它)。HashMap从一开始就是集合的一部分。还要注意的是,Hashtable扩展了Dictionary类,正如Javadocs所述,这是过时的,并...
这样的话不是不行,还是因为效率问题! 所以JDK采用了预处理的方法,这时loadFactor就派上了用场,当size>initialCapacity*loadFactor时,Java虚拟机就在内部实现了新的rehash,重新扩充hash桶的数量,在目前的实现中,是增加一倍,这样就保证当你真正想put新的元素时效率不会明显下降。 所以其实一般情况下HashMap并不存在键值...
Java 集合框架。 与新的集合实现不同, Hashtable 同步。 如果不需要线程安全实现,建议使用 HashMap 代替Hashtable。 如果需要线程安全高度并发实现,则建议使用 java.util.concurrent.ConcurrentHashMap 代替Hashtable。 在1.0 中添加。 适用于 . 的 java.util.HashtableJava 文档本...
除了HashMap允许空值,而Hashtable不允许以外。还请注意,Hashtable扩展了Dictionary类,该类在Javadocs中已经过时,已被Map接口所取代。请记住,HashTable是在引入Java集合框架(JCF)之前的遗留类,后来进行了改进以实现Map接口。Vector和Stack也是如此。因此,在新代码中始终远离它们,因为正如其他人指出的那样,JCF中总...
下面是比较常见的构造方法三种方法(Java 7 docs),HashMap()Constructs an empty HashMap with the ...
http://java.sun.com/j2se/1.4.2/docs/api/java/util/HashMap.html http://java.sun.com/j2se/1.4.2/docs/api/java/util/Hashtable.html http://java.sun.com/j2se/1.5.0/docs/api/java/util/LinkedList.html http://java.sun.com/j2se/1.5.0/docs/api/java/util/TreeMap.html ...
Parameters: key- key with which the specified value is to be associated remappingFunction- the remapping function to compute a value Returns: the new value associated with the specified key, or null if none Throws: ConcurrentModificationException- if it is detected that the remapping function modif...
Java.Interop.Expressions Java.Interop.Tools.JavaCallableWrappers Java.IO Java.Lang Java.Lang.Annotation Java.Lang.Invoke Java.Lang.Ref Java.Lang.Reflect Java.Lang.Runtimes Java.Math(Java 數學庫) Java.Net Java.Nio Java.Nio.Channels Java.Nio.Channels.Spi Java.Nio.Charset Java.Nio.Charset.Spi Java...
http://java.sun.com/j2se/1.4.2/docs/api/java/util/HashMap.html http://java.sun.com/j2se/1.4.2/docs/api/java/util/Hashtable.html http://java.sun.com/j2se/1.5.0/docs/api/java/util/LinkedList.html http://java.sun.com/j2se/1.5.0/docs/api/java/util/TreeMap.html ...